## Authentication

The shrinkray CLI resizes image batches against the Foldcrest render farm, and every invocation must be authenticated. On first run, shrinkray looks for credentials in ~/.shrinkray/credentials, then in the SHRINKRAY_TOKEN environment variable, in that order. Tokens are scoped per project, so a token minted for one workspace will be rejected elsewhere with a 403 — check the scope before filing a bug. For local development against the staging farm, use the bearer token below.

login token, bagug-kafop: eyJhbGciOiJIUzI1NiIsInR5cCI6IkpXVCJ9.eyJzdWIiOiIcMLov2In0.Z5RLDIfp

Release checklist — Fanwheel queue-depth autoscaler. Confirm the scaler observes the new depth metric from Harborline, not the deprecated gauge. Soak in staging for 24h with synthetic burst load; verify scale-down cooldown holds at five minutes. Rollback path is the pinned previous manifest. Once soak passes, record the promotion in the sync notes along with the build token printed below.

build token for kagaf-hahof: htk14_9d3d4d26d7d8de

Ticket QRY-4417 — Vault locked during planner regression triage. Plugin authors: the Hollowfen query planner regression (v3.2) is being bisected, but the test-fixture vault auto-locked after repeated failed attempts. You will need to reopen it to run the regression corpus against your extensions. Please handle this credential with care and do not redistribute it. The vault recovery passphrase follows immediately below.

strongbox words: sorir-belvan-rusix-ulays-ralmir-praix-eliir-tamax-praael-druael-julir-tamius-jorir

Step 3: Rebuild the autocomplete index. The legacy Swiftprompt index degrades badly past two million entries, which is why suggestions have been slow for larger tenants. This release replaces it with a sharded prefix index maintained by the plugin host. Run the rebuild command once per tenant, then verify latency in the dashboard. Target the index database with the following connection string.

primary connection of tawif-yajeg = postgresql://rusiel_svc:G879q9cx6GsSvj@db-dd9f.norvagrid.internal:5432/casath